Harfang Up 60% as Drilling at its Sky Lake Project Shows High-Grade Mineralization
May 26, 2025 7:53 AM

12:14 PM EDT, 05/14/2025 (MT Newswires) -- Harfang Exploration ( HRFEF ) was last seen up 60% after the company on Wednesday said exploration drilling at its Sky Lake gold project in northwest Ontario showed some high-grade mineralization and identified two new gold zones on the property

The company said best results from the exploration program included 18 meters of core testing at 7.0 gold-equivalent grams per tonne.

Harfang also said it discovered two high-grade mineralized zones in a kilometer-long shear zone, with the first batch of drill results providing early confirmation of a "significant mineralized gold system".

"The significant interval of 7 grams per tonne gold over 18 metres, a metal factor of 126 gram-metres, is a fantastic start," said chief executive Rick Breger. "We believe that Sky Lake is perfectly situated along an underexplored greenstone belt in a geologic environment that is ripe for mineralization. We have all the typical ingredients of an Abitibi-like orogenic-style gold deposit, such as the mineralogy, alteration patterns, and veining."

The company's shares were last seen up $0.045 to $0.12 on the TSX Venture Exchange.
